PUBLIC PROSECUTIONS.
THE NEW DIRECTOR. IVJR E. H- T. ATKINSON. (Oflicial Wireless.) RUGBY, March 12. The Home Secretary has appointed Mr Edward Hall Tindal Atkinson Director of Public Prosecutions, in place of Sir Archibald Bodkin, who will retire on pension. Mr E. 11. T. Atkinson, C.8.E., barrister at law, is a judge of the County Courts and is 57 years of age. He was called to the Bar in 1902. During the war he was Assistant-Secretary to tlie War Trade Advisory and the Civil Aeriel Transport Committee. He attended the Peace Conference in France in 1919 in an oflicial capacity, and also the International Air Commission in the same year.
